Varieties of Clover
Common Types of Clover and Their Characteristics
Clover is a versatile plant belonging to the legume family, with several varieties that exhibit unique characteristics. One of the most common types is white clover, known for its low-growing habit and ability to thrive in various soil conditions. It is often used in lawns and pastures due to its nitrogen-fixing properties. This makes it beneficial for soil health. Many gardeners appreciate its resilience.
Another popular variety is red clover, which is talldr and has a more robust growth pattern. It features striking pinkish-purple flowers that attract pollinators. This variety is often used in forage systems and as a cover crop. It can improve soil fertility significantly. Its beauty is a bonus.
Additionally, there is alsike clover, which is a hybrid of red and whitened clover . It is particularly valued for its adaptability to wet conditions. This makes it suitable for areas with poor drainage. Its ability to thrive in diverse environments is impressive.
Lastly, sweet clover, which includes yellow and white varieties, is known for its sweet-smelling flowers and is often used in honey production. It can grow quite tall and is typically found in disturbed areas. Its fragrance is delightful. Each type of clover serves a specific purpose, contributing to both agricultural practices and ecological balance.
Uses of Clover
Agricultural and Ecological Benefits
Clover offers significant agricultural and ecological benefits, making it a valuable asset in various farming practices. One of its primary uses is as a cover crop, which helps prevent soil erosion and improves soil structure. This is particularly important for maintaining soil health over time. Healthy soil is essential for sustainable agriculture.
Moreover, clover is an excellent nitrogen fixer, meaning it can convert atmospheric nitrogen into a form that plants can use. This natural process reduces the need for synthetic fertilizers, which can be costly and harmful to the environment. By incorporating clover into crop rotations, farmers can enhance soil fertility and reduce input costs. This is a smart financial strategy.
In addition to its agricultural benefits, clover plays a crucial role in supporting biodiversity. It provides habitat and food for various pollinators, such as bees and butterflies. These insects are vital for the pollination of many crops, directly impacting agricultural productivity. Protecting pollinators is essential for food security.
Furthermore, clover can be used in pasture systems to improve livestock nutrition. Its high protein content makes it an excellent forage option for grazing animals. This can lead to healthier livestock and better meat and milk production. Healthy animals contribute to a more profitable farming operation.
Growing and Maintaining Clover
Tips for Successful Clover Cultivation
To successfully cultivate clover, he should begin by selecting the appropriate variety for his specific climate and soil conditions. Different clover types have unique growth requirements. This choice can significantly impact his overall success. Understanding local conditions is crucial.
Next, he should prepare the soil adequately before planting. This involves testing the soil pH and ensuring it falls within the optimal range for clover, typically between 6.0 and 7.0. Proper soil preparation promotes healthy root development. Healthy roots lead to robust plants.
When planting, he should aim for a seeding rate that ensures good coverage without overcrowding. This balance allows each plant to access necessary resources. Spacing is key for optimal growth. A well-planned layout can enhance yields.
After planting, regular maintenance is essfntial for clover health. He should monitor for pests and diseases, addressing any issues promptly to prevent crop loss. Vigilance is important in agriculture. Additionally, he should consider periodic mowing to encourage denser growth and prevent flowering if he aims for forage production. This practice can improve forage quality.
Finally, he should ensure adequate moisture, especially during dry spells. Clover requires consistent watering to thrive. Irrigation can be a game changer. By following these tips, he can achieve a successful clover crop that benefits his agricultural goals.
